The MAX9814 Microphone Amplifier Module is a high-performance audio amplifier designed to provide clear and amplified audio signals from microphones. Featuring built-in Auto Gain Control (AGC), this module automatically adjusts the amplification level based on the input signal, ensuring consistent audio output and minimizing distortion.

| Supply Voltage |
2.7V to 5.5V |
|---|---|
| Output Type |
Analog voltage signal |
| Gain Control |
Automatic gain control with adjustable settings |
| Frequency Response |
Designed for high-fidelity audio applications |
| Operating Temperature |
Typically -40°C to +85°C |
